Abstract

Provided is a method of controlling states of a secondary cell by a user equipment. The method may include receiving SCell state indication information indicating a state for the SCell from a base station through an RRC message or a MAC control element, configuring the state of the SCell in an activation state or a dormant state on the basis of the SCell state indication information, and transmitting channel state information for the SCell to the base station in accordance with CQI configuration information configured for the SCell.

Claims (46)

1. A method of controlling states of a secondary cell (SCell) by a user equipment, the method comprising:

receiving SCell state indication information indicating a state for the SCell from a base station through a radio resource control (RRC) message or a medium access control (MAC) control element;

configuring the state of the SCell in one of an activation state and a dormant state based on the SCell state indication information; and

transmitting channel state information for the SCell to the base station in accordance with channel quality indicator (CQI) configuration information configured for the SCell,

wherein the transmitting comprises:

transmitting channel state information for the SCell to the base station by applying a value of a first activation state CQI report parameter contained in a first CQI configuration information when the first CQI configuration information for the SCell is configured in the user equipment, and

transmitting channel state information for the SCell to the base station by applying a value of a second CQI report parameter contained in second CQI configuration information when the first CQI configuration information is not configured in the user equipment, and

wherein:

the first CQI configuration information and the second CQI configuration information comprise different CQI report periods and offset values; and

the CQI report period contained in the first CQI configuration information is set as a shorter value than the CQI report period contained in the second CQI configuration information.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the configuring comprises:

configuring the SCell in the activation state when the SCell state indication information indicates the activation state, and

starts or restarts a SCell dormant timer when the SCell dormant timer is configured in association with the SCell.
